As I recall, he gives some nice navigation tips that don't involve his J-Tunes scripts. When Brian first wrote his scripts in 2005, there was no other way to access iTunes and the iTunes Store except with his scripts. Since I didn't want to use iTunes to organize my music, I wasn't interested in J-Tunes, and I thought the price was too high. Now that iTunes and the iTunes Store are more accessible with JAWS and other Screen readers, and I use iTunes to feed my iPod Touch, I can use iTunes to do what I need to do, and I still think the price of the scripts is too high. The J-Tunes scripts add a lot of convenience to the use of iTunes and havea lot of built-in Help. It's up to you whether you want to pay the price for this convenience and Help.
